Gluten development in batters and doughs is influenced by several factors:
- Mixing equipment used: Different types of mixing equipment can affect the amount of gluten development in the dough. For example, using a stand mixer with a dough hook can result in more gluten development compared to hand mixing.
- Altitude and atmospheric pressure: High altitude and low atmospheric pressure can cause the dough to rise faster and result in less gluten development.
- Type of leavening agent: The type of leavening agent used, such as yeast or baking powder, can affect gluten development. Yeast allows for more gluten development compared to baking powder.
- Gluten-free ingredients: The use of gluten-free ingredients, such as gluten-free flour, can prevent gluten development in the dough.
- Amount of water: The amount of water used in the batter or dough can affect gluten development. More water can lead to more gluten development.
- Amount of kneading: The amount of kneading or mixing time can influence gluten development. Over-kneading can result in excessive gluten development and lead to a tougher texture.
- Rising time: The duration of the rising time can impact gluten development. Longer rising times allow for more gluten development.
